About this district

The intellectual heart of West Beirut, built around Hamra Street and the campus of the American University of Beirut, and long the city's hub of students, writers and café culture. Hamra is bookshops, theatres, cinemas and a mix of galleries threaded through a dense, busy, cosmopolitan grid that runs down toward the seafront Corniche. It carries the memory of Beirut's mid-century golden age and remains its most bookish, argumentative quarter. The pace is urban. The culture is verbal as much as visual.
